> On Wed, Nov 05, 2014 at 03:30:37PM +0200, Qinglai Xiao wrote:
> > User defined tag calculation has access to mbuf.
> > Default tag is RSS hash result.
> >
> 
> Interesting idea.
> Did you investigate was there any performance improvement or regression comparing
> whether the callback was called per-packet as packets were dequeued for distribution
> (i.e. how you have things now in your patch), compared to calling
> the callback in a loop to extract the tags for all packets initially? I suspect
> there probably isn't much performance difference either way, but it may be worth
> checking.
> One other point, is that I think the callback to extract the tag should have
> additional parameters - at least one, if not two. I would suggest that the
> distributor pointer be passed in, as well as an arbitrary void * pointer.


Just wonder, why do you need a call-back?
Why not just make rte_distributor_process() to accept an extra parameter: array of tags?

rte_distributor_process(struct rte_distributor *d,
                struct rte_mbuf **mbufs, uint32_t *mbuf_tags, unsigned num_mbufs)

?
